欢迎访问宙启技术站
智能推送

Python的max()和min()函数在列表中的应用

发布时间:2023-06-21 03:40:25

Python的max()和min()函数是内置函数,在列表中的应用非常方便。max()函数返回列表中的最大值,而min()函数返回列表中的最小值。这两个函数都需要传入一个列表作为参数。

我们可以通过以下代码示例来演示max()和min()函数在列表中的应用:

# 创建一个列表
my_list = [3, 5, 2, 8, 1, 6]

# 使用max()函数获取列表中的最大值
max_value = max(my_list)
print("max value is:", max_value)

# 使用min()函数获取列表中的最小值
min_value = min(my_list)
print("min value is:", min_value)

输出结果为:

max value is: 8
min value is: 1

以上代码中,我们创建了一个列表my_list,里面包含了一些整数。然后,我们分别使用max()和min()函数获取了列表中的最大值和最小值。最后,我们使用print()函数将这两个值输出到控制台。

除了上述的示例,max()和min()函数在列表中还有很多应用场景。例如,我们可以使用这两个函数来计算列表元素的总和、平均值等等。以下是一个示例:

# 创建一个列表
my_list = [3, 5, 2, 8, 1, 6]

# 使用sum()函数计算列表元素的总和
sum_value = sum(my_list)
print("sum value is:", sum_value)

# 使用len()函数计算列表的长度
list_length = len(my_list)

# 使用sum()函数和len()函数计算列表元素的平均值
average_value = sum_value / list_length
print("average value is:", average_value)

输出结果为:

sum value is: 25
average value is: 4.166666666666667

以上代码中,我们首先使用sum()函数计算了列表元素的总和。然后,我们使用len()函数计算了列表的长度。最后,我们使用sum()函数和len()函数计算了列表元素的平均值,并将结果输出到控制台。

总之,max()和min()函数是Python中非常实用的内置函数,可以方便地获取列表中的最大值和最小值。同时,通过这两个函数结合其他函数,我们可以很方便地完成一些数学计算。在Python开发中,应该尽量多利用内置函数,提高代码的效率和可读性。